Highlights
Are people in Norman older or younger than people in Durant?
- The Median Age in Norman is 2.9 years younger than in Durant.

Are housing costs cheaper in Norman or Durant?
- Norman housing costs are 15.3% more expensive than Durant hous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Norman or Durant?
- The average commute for residents of Norman is 7.0 minutes longer than it is for residents of Durant.

Things to do in Norman?
Norman, Oklahoma is a vibrant city in central Oklahoma that offers plenty of activities for all ages. For those looking to get outdoors there are several parks and recreation areas such as the Riverwind Casino, Lake Thunderbird State Park, and Lions Park. Arts and culture fans can enjoy visiting museums like the Sam Noble Oklahoma Museum of Natural History or catching a performance by the local symphony. Shopping and dining experiences range everywhere from traditional cowboy stores to fine Italian dining.
